HPD Arrests Man Found Slumped Over Steering Wheel

Henderson, KY 3/24/21- Just before 9AM this morning, the Henderson Police Department responded to the 1500 block of S. Green Street for a man being slumped over the steering wheel of his vehicle, while the vehicle was still running.

When officers arrived on scene they located David Snodgrass, 35 of Henderson, behind the wheel of a Mazda in the parking lot of Henderson Pet’s. Snodgrass was arrested and charged for:

  • operating a motor vehicle under the influence of alcohol/ substances (3rd offense);
  • resisting arrest;
  • terroristic threatening (3rd degree);
  • disorderly conduct (2nd degree);
  • possession of marijuana;
  • possession of meth;
  • possession of drug paraphernalia;
  • possession of an open alcoholic beverage container.

Snodgrass was transported and lodged at Henderson County Detention Center. The Henderson Police Department is still investigating the case.
